I bought a pretty fleecy blanket for our new puppy just before we picked her up and with in days it was ripped to shreds. She was luckily quite sensible and spat the bits out but she just could not resist ripping up the bedding every night. Several blankets later I mentioned this to a friend and he suggested vet bed. I was rather staggered by the price but he assured me it would be indestructible and it was. Puppy is now 18 months old and her vet bed is her prized possesion. She takes it every where with her and although she manages to rip a few bits off the edge she has yet to completely destroy a piece.
Vet bed, as the name suggests, was originally used by vets and has moved into the pet market. Vets like it because it can be washed on a hot wash. I find it washes well and comes out of the washer nearly dry as most of the moisture spins out. I wash mine fairly regularly to stop the doggy smell and it refluffs (is that a word?) it for her. Vet bed comes in different grades with some extra thick piles for elderly or arthritic dogs. I bought the standard and which my dog seems to find confortable, indeed she carries it around to sit on.
One other big advantage to vet bed is it can be bought off a roll so you can buy whatever size or shape you want or cut it down to size.
The only disadvantage is the price but it is probably cheaper than replacing chewed up blankets all the time.

Summary: An excellent bedding for chewy puppies
